38C in Japan and Now Your Forehead's on Fire. Say This at the Drugstore.
To say I have a fever in Japanese, say 熱があります (netsu ga arimasu).
It's 38 degrees outside, and now it's 38 on your forehead too. At a Japanese drugstore, one sentence gets you help fast.
熱があります
netsu ga arimasu
I have a fever
In this video
- 熱があります。 netsu ga arimasu. I have a fever.
- すみません、熱があります。 sumimasen, netsu ga arimasu. Excuse me, I have a fever.
